About N-[2-(5-chloro-2,3-dihydro-1,4-benzodioxin-7-yl)ethyl]-2-(N-ethylanilino)acetamide
N-[2-(5-chloro-2,3-dihydro-1,4-benzodioxin-7-yl)ethyl]-2-(N-ethylanilino)acetamide (PubChem CID 55838690) has the molecular formula C20H23ClN2O3
and a molecular weight of 374.87 g/mol. Its IUPAC name is N-[2-(5-chloro-2,3-dihydro-1,4-benzodioxin-7-yl)ethyl]-2-(N-ethylanilino)acetamide.

What is the SMILES notation for N-[2-(5-chloro-2,3-dihydro-1,4-benzodioxin-7-yl)ethyl]-2-(N-ethylanilino)acetamide?
The canonical SMILES for N-[2-(5-chloro-2,3-dihydro-1,4-benzodioxin-7-yl)ethyl]-2-(N-ethylanilino)acetamide is CCN(CC(=O)NCCc1cc(Cl)c2c(c1)OCCO2)c1ccccc1.
What is the InChIKey of N-[2-(5-chloro-2,3-dihydro-1,4-benzodioxin-7-yl)ethyl]-2-(N-ethylanilino)acetamide?
The InChIKey is XITBEJQELOVOHE-UHFFFAOYSA-N. The full InChI is InChI=1S/C20H23ClN2O3/c1-2-23(16-6-4-3-5-7-16)14-19(24)22-9-8-15-12-17(21)20-18(13-15)25-10-11-26-20/h3-7,12-13H,2,8-11,14H2,1H3,(H,22,24).
What are the key properties of N-[2-(5-chloro-2,3-dihydro-1,4-benzodioxin-7-yl)ethyl]-2-(N-ethylanilino)acetamide?
N-[2-(5-chloro-2,3-dihydro-1,4-benzodioxin-7-yl)ethyl]-2-(N-ethylanilino)acetamide has a molecular weight of 374.87 g/mol, XLogP of 3.30, 7 rotatable bonds, 1 hydrogen bond donors, and 4 hydrogen bond acceptors.
